Try our experimental JupyterLite console with Ibis, using the Palmer
penguins[^1] dataset loaded into the DuckDB backend!
{{< include ../../_tabsets/repl_warning.qmd >}}
```{python}
#| echo: false
#| output: asis
from urllib.parse import urlencode
lines = """
%pip install numpy pandas tzdata
import pyodide_js, pathlib, js
await pyodide_js.loadPackage("https://storage.googleapis.com/ibis-wasm-wheels/pyarrow-16.0.0.dev2661%2Bg9bddb87fd-cp311-cp311-emscripten_3_1_46_wasm32.whl")
pathlib.Path("penguins.csv").write_text(await (await js.fetch("https://storage.googleapis.com/ibis-tutorial-data/penguins.csv")).text())
del pyodide_js, pathlib, js
%clear
%pip install 'ibis-framework[duckdb]'
from ibis.interactive import *
penguins = ibis.read_csv("penguins.csv")
penguins
"""
params = [
("toolbar", "1"),
("theme", "JupyterLab Night"),
("kernel", "python"),
]
params.extend(("code", line) for line in lines.splitlines() if line)
query = urlencode(params)
jupyterlite = f"../../jupyterlite/repl/?{query}"
iframe = f'<iframe src="{jupyterlite}" id="jupyterlite-console"></iframe>'
print(iframe)
```
